Transaction 65ff77cdbc15f273023e9974dfd5e93f75e76b2e9b29153d4317cef277747149
2 Input
2 Outputs
- 65ff77cdbc15f273023e9974dfd5e93f75e76b2e9b29153d4317cef277747149:0
- 65ff77cdbc15f273023e9974dfd5e93f75e76b2e9b29153d4317cef277747149:1
value 8650357
address 1KUi3wdhp2RPLkoJnydDth6ZZHPuLH7sSC
value 4000000
address 1AvRjSMoQrHyPgnbZ2J2n5jrTheYwme7GW